让人心紧的现实:自制USDT冷钱包是否安全?

在当下的加密货币环境中,冷钱包因其安全性受到越来越多用户的青睐。然而,你是否意识到,自制USDT冷钱包的过程并非如想象中那样简单?可能只需一个简单的操作失误,就可能导致你的资产面临失窃的风险。例如,2019年6月,某知名项目的开发者因为在自制硬件钱包时未能正确防范硬件篡改,导致数百万美元的资产被盗。这是一个令人痛心的教训,也是对所有自制硬钱包用户的警示。

具体来说,许多人存在一个误区:以为自制冷钱包就一定比托管在交易所安全。但在这里需要强调的是,**自制冷钱包的安全性取决于设计、实施及验证过程的严谨程度**。若其中任意一个环节出现纰漏,风险将不可小觑。

安全原理:硬件钱包的基础与挑战

要理解自制冷钱包的安全性,我们需要了解硬件钱包的工作原理。首先,硬件钱包通常依赖于**安全芯片**来存储私钥。安全芯片(如TPM或安全元素)能够防篡改,确保生成的私钥不会被泄露。而自制钱包如果没有经过严格设计与测试,自然缺乏这样的保护。

其次,自制硬钱包里的随机数生成至关重要。通常,硬件钱包使用的是**真实随机数生成器(TRNG)**,而不是伪随机数生成器(PRNG)。TRNG通过物理噪声生成随机数,相较于PRNG更难预测,安全性更高。因此,无论选择哪种方法生成私钥,你必须确保使用的随机数生成机制是安全的。

风险拆解:自制冷钱包的痛点

在创建自制冷钱包时,面临着多个潜在的风险,其中尤以以下几点尤为重要:

  • 固件验证漏洞:如果自制硬件钱包的固件无法通过有效的验证手段,攻击者可以轻松植入恶意程序以窃取私钥。这种情况在开源项目中尤其普遍,很多自制钱包未能进行充分的固件审查。
  • 安全芯片的缺失:缺少安全芯片意味着钱包很可能脆弱。普通微控制器无法有效抵御物理攻击,攻击者可以通过侧信道攻击等方式提取私钥。
  • 盲签名风险:在使用盲签名进行交易时,如果没有完善的安全措施,用户可能意外签署恶意交易。这种攻击方式曾在2021年被广泛报道,涉及多个项目的损失。

实操建议:如何增强冷钱包的安全性

既然我们已经识别了自制冷钱包的风险,接下来,针对这些风险,我们应采取相应的实操策略以增强冷钱包的安全性:

  1. 使用受信任的芯片技术:尽量选购市场上获得良好口碑的安全芯片,如Microchip的ATECC系列或STMicroelectronics的STSAFE系列等。这些芯片内置的安全特性足以让你的私钥得到强有力的保护。
  2. 应用TRNG技术:在随机数生成环节,强调选择支持TRNG的硬件。如果条件允许,使用专用的TRNG模块生成私钥,提高密钥的随机性和安全性。
  3. 固件完整性验证:确保所有固件都经过数字签名,并在加载时进行完整性检查。这可以有效防止恶意代码的植入,增强自制钱包的安全性。
  4. 物理安全防护:将硬件钱包放在物理上安全的环境中,避免未经授权的访问。对硬件的物理接入进行限制,确保只有你能够进行更改或操作。

现在,回头看看你的设置,确保你在每一个环节都进行了严格的把关。自制冷钱包在保障资产安全方面有诸多不确定性,切勿自以为是。我们的每一个细节都有可能成为防线的关键,保护好资产,才是我们每个用户应尽的责任。